
What is “Agents of Discovery?”
Agents of Discovery is a place-based educational augmented reality app easily played by families, individuals, or K-12 students from a mobile device. The app allows users to further connect with and discover the unique resources of the state park they are visiting. At the park, users are able to search for challenges and answer questions about the park’s resources. Download the app from your mobile device’s app store and play for free. The app does not require WiFi or cellular data to play once a mission is downloaded. more…
